WIRING FORMATS (cont’d)
BIC-II / OCM-II Interconnection
to other products
as required
1. BIC-II, ports 1-6, RX input is non-polarized.
2. Refer to instruction manual PL-269 for wiring of the OCM-II.
3. Interconnecting cable shield should be grounded at CVCC only. Insulate shields at junctions to prevent
inadvertent grounding. Use Belden cable 9552, 2 pair shielded 18 AWG or equivalent.
Maximum communication loop length is 3000 m (10,000 ft ) for BIC-II / CVCC interconnecting cable.
Maximum run is 15 m ( 50 ft ) for OCM-II / CVCC interconnecting cable.
4. All wiring, whether in non-hazardous (as shown) or hazardous areas, must be done in conjunction with
approved conduit, boxes and fittings, and to procedures in accordance with all governing regulations.
